Sandeshkhali: CBI seizes huge cache of arms in Sandeshkhali

The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) on Friday found a large number of arms and ammunitions, including foreign-made pistol and revolvers, during search operations conducted at two premises in North 24 Parganas district’s Sandeshkhali, in connection with the attack on the Enforcement Directorate officials on January 5 by followers of now suspended Trinamool leader Shahjahan Sheikh.
National Security Guard’s Bomb Disposal Squad was also called in to the spot and crude bombs were diffused in the area today.

The CBI, in the Calcutta High Court-monitored probe, is already investigating an attack on the ED team by a mob allegedly instigated by Sheikh and all the land grab and torture on women related cases.

The CBI team conducted searches at the residences of an associate of Sheikh, following a tip off.

“During investigation of the ED attack case, information was received that the items lost by the ED team and other incriminating articles may be hidden at the residence of an associate of Sheikh at Sandeshkhali. Accordingly, the CBI team along with CRPF personnel searched two premises at Sandeshkhali village today,” the central agency said in a statement.

Several teams of CBI officials, with support from West Bengal Police, and central forces, including the NSG, conducted the search operations. During searches, the CBI recovered a huge number of arms and ammunitions, including three foreign- made revolvers, one Indian revolver, one colt official police revolver, a foreign-made pistol, 120 nine mm bullets and a huge number of cartridges were also recovered. “Many incriminating documents related to Sheikh Shahjahan have also been recovered. Some items suspected to be country-made bombs have also been recovered which are being handled and disposed of by the teams from NSG,” a CBI statement said. An automated robot was brought in by the NSG during bomb disposal and the locality was evacuated, people in the know said. The premises were cordoned off by the security forces, amid water bodies and fisheries used for fish farming which are predominant in the region. Sheikh was arrested by the West Bengal Police on February 29 in connection with the attack by around 1,000 people, in which three ED officials were injured.Amid the political mudslinging, Trinamool leader Kunal Ghosh said, “There may be a conspiracy behind this. If arms have entered Sandeshkhali, it may be to malign us, or create a drama.”

“NSG commandos are recovering foreign arms from Sandeshkhali. This state has turned into a box of explosives. We have seen CBI, ED, NIA and now it is NSG,” BJP leader Suvendu Adhikari said.
